I have a big problem… I followed the dual boot tutorial from the forum “root-tip-dual-boot-manjaro-and-windows” (sorry can’t enter links here I guess) and everything seemed to work until after the installation and the first boot.
When booting the error “unknown filesystem” appears and grub rescue starts. I had this problem in a past dualboot installation and knew this can be fixed. So I did the following:
I searched with ls for the hd with ext2 as filesystem. For my surprise there are two of them (hd1,gpt7) and (hd1,gpt8)
I guess gpt8 is the home partition, since there are only the folders lost+found and usrname/
Whereas gpt7 contains boot, dev, home, … and under boot I find grub which contains the directors “x86_64-efi”
Therefore I enter the following commands:
$set root=(hd1,gpt7)
$set prefix=(hd1,gpt7)/boot/grub
$insmod normal
And now an error appears:
“Symbol ‘grub_calloc’ not found.”
A quick research told me that I may have some problems since uefi may not be setup right in the bios. However if I press F2 during startup I do not enter grub rescue but get to a black screen with just the “_”-symbol on it. It seems like I cannot enter bios either.
I do have a bootable USB but is there a way I can manage boot order in grub rescue or any other help?
